Butler County schools ranked by test score
Latest ISASP year (2024-25). 7 schools in Butler County, Iowa with reported English Language Arts scores. Iowa state average: 73.7%.
| Rank | School | Level | English Language Arts | vs state |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Aplington-Parkersburg High School Parkersburg · Aplington-Parkersburg Comm School District | High | 90.3% | +16.6pp |
| 2 | Clarksville High School Clarksville · Clarksville Comm School District | High | 87.6% | +13.9pp |
| 3 | Aplington-Parkersburg Middle School Aplington · Aplington-Parkersburg Comm School District | Middle | 83.5% | +9.8pp |
| 4 | North Butler Elementary Allison · North Butler Comm School District | Elementary | 78.9% | +5.2pp |
| 5 | North Butler Jr/Sr High School Greene · North Butler Comm School District | High | 72.1% | -1.6pp |
| 6 | Aplington Elementary School Aplington · Aplington-Parkersburg Comm School District | Elementary | 70.2% | -3.5pp |
| 7 | Clarksville Elementary School Clarksville · Clarksville Comm School District | Elementary | 67.9% | -5.8pp |
About this ranking
Schools are ranked by the percentage of students who scored at or above the ISASP % Proficient threshold on the latest available ISASP English Language Arts test (school year 2024-25). Only public schools in Butler County, Iowa with a reasonable cohort size are shown. A higher percentage is better.
